Recent selections would seem to indicate that the NCAA has given up on avoiding second-round matchups (in fact the new travel rules say only first-round guidelines still apply), and at any rate, I don't think they've explicitly played with things to trade one intraconference matchup for another.

The thing that annoys me most about this year is that the committee demonstrated it has basically arbitrary power when it re-drew the brackets which were explicitly contained in the championships handbook, meaning that even the subset of the process which they spell out there is subject to change.  What was Keith saying about arbitrariness and subjectivity?
